    I was wondering if there was a guide on what hardware to use with TunerPro to read an ECM and then get writing XDF's to be used in HP Tuners.

  4. #4
    Quote Originally Posted by calgarylsswapper View Post
    I was wondering if there was a guide on what hardware to use with TunerPro to read an ECM and then get writing XDF's to be used in HP Tuners.
    You don't need to read the ecm with anything other than HPT. You can download the files from Ford and convert them to a .bin.
    https://www.fordtechservice.dealerco...?swproduct=IDS

    If you do want to read the .bin directly from the ecu, PCMflash now supports the 6.7s. https://ecutools.eu/chip-tuning/pcmflash/module-75/
    $145 for that module, $19 for the dongle to license the software, plus a J2534 interface. Probably the cheapest way to read the ecu.

    Quote Originally Posted by JaegerWrenching View Post
    What are you using to convert them to a .bin?
    There are a handful of different tools out there that will do it. With the newer 6.7 files you have to have a utility to decrypt the Volvo Build File (VBF) before you can convert it with the pre-existing tools. If you do a google search for VBF tool you can find a free utility that will handle the conversion. The older Packed Hex Files (PHF) don't have as much support out there, but I believe that with the right plugins you can convert all of the files with WinOLS.     I have software called VBF Tool 2.2.0 that works up to the '16 files. Then they changed them and I get someone with the WinOLS .vbf add-on to convert them for me.
